const int N=1e6+3;
ll f[N];
void solve() {
    // f[i]: số cách để tung được tổng là i
    // thcs: f[1..6]=1
    // f[i] += f[i-j]
    f[0]=1;
    f[1]=1;
    cin >> n;
    FOR(i,2,n) { /// can tim tong i
        FOR(j,1,6) { /// co so cach tung dc tong j
            if (i-j>=0)
                f[i]=(f[i]+f[i-j])%MOD;
        }
    }
    cout << f[n];

}
